Output e6e04d4e9d13fd19ceb76ea820105c8e3dfa39861a7d9be3ed71fe6cab3d02ee:1

value
666667
script pubkey
OP_0 OP_PUSHBYTES_20 551735587fc3fc43e7528bbe93ab24ffa2961a75
address
bc1q25tn2krlc07y8e6j3wlf82eyl73fvxn4aawx43
transaction
e6e04d4e9d13fd19ceb76ea820105c8e3dfa39861a7d9be3ed71fe6cab3d02ee
confirmations
29194
spent
true